Output 3caaa6790d641c19adf6399df12e3fc1577dc20b07a9dd079d1ca3e07bbe3870:4

value
1812100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 480eb95107efc546d6ba9f7f3c61ac2626906002 OP_EQUAL
address
38G2DPYg8FAZGPxXBwf9B7GQDwZq4Wmm8M
transaction
3caaa6790d641c19adf6399df12e3fc1577dc20b07a9dd079d1ca3e07bbe3870
confirmations
126630
spent
false